Celebrity Makeup Artist Etienne Ortega Dishes On How to Glam Up With His New PUR Palette (Exclusive)
Pur-fection! Celebrity makeup artist Etienne Ortega teamed up with PUR Cosmetics to create the PUR PRO eye shadow palette that evokes his signature style of effortless glamour. Ortega got his break in the industry from working with A-listers including Christina Aguilera and Khloe Kardashian. In a new exclusive interview with Stylish, he dishes on how to re-create their iconic beauty looks — scroll through to see their looks and get the details!

"My inspiration was to create a versatile and timeless palette and one that isn’t based on current trends, so it allows you to create a multitude of looks," Ortega explains ."The shades work for any type of skin color and on any type of woman. I was inspired by my clients and the looks we like to play with, so I designed it keeping in mind that it would be my go-to palette for them," he adds.
To apply the shadows in true celeb fashion, Ortega recommends using a blending brush. He says, "The shades are very easy to blend, but I always love to have a blending brush. It is key to a really flawless finished look. You can also use a shadow applicator brush and a sponge wand."
"For Kate Bekinsale's look, I stuck to cooler, purply shades such as Paradise," he dishes. "Since it was for a red carpet event, we made it a little more dramatic and smoked out her eye and accentuated towards the outer corner of her eye for a dramatic effect." Another pro-tip? "Wetting any of your brushes and dipping them into the colors will intensify the pigment of the shadow."
To make Paris Hilton's eyes truly pop, Ortega reveals that he used a white liner on the lower lash line. He says, "Using a white liner really gives you the illusion of a more open eye!"
